A 21-year-old Spanish student was murdered on Saturday night (12) in Cuautla, in the Mexican state of Morelos, during a university exchange. Claudia Tacoronte Aguilera, from the University of Granada, was about a month in the country when she was killed in the vicinity of the House of Culture of the municipality, about 100 kilometers from Mexico City.
